Operating System Compatibility
Different operating systems (iOS, Android) handle app icon replacement using distinct mechanisms. iOS typically relies on shortcuts or configuration profiles, creating a proxy icon rather than directly modifying the application itself. Android offers more direct modification capabilities through third-party launchers or, in some cases, built-in theming options. Therefore, the feasibility and method of app icon replacement are intrinsically linked to the underlying operating system.

The selection of a particular customization method dictates the steps involved in the process. On Android devices, third-party launchers often provide built-in functionality for icon replacement. This simplifies the procedure, allowing users to select an image from their device’s storage and apply it directly to the application icon displayed on the home screen. Conversely, on iOS, the “Shortcuts” application offers a method to create a new home screen icon that links to the Instagram application. This approach involves creating an intermediary shortcut, effectively masking the original application icon rather than modifying it directly. The choice of using a launcher versus a shortcut significantly impacts the implementation and user experience.

iOS Restrictions on Direct Application Modification
The iOS operating system implements stringent security measures that generally prevent direct modification of application resources, including icons. This restriction necessitates the use of workaround methods, such as the “Shortcuts” app, which create a proxy icon that launches the Instagram application. This workaround introduces an additional layer of indirection, potentially impacting launch speed and deviating from the standard application launch process. The operating system’s core design inhibits direct alteration of the application’s core files.
-
Android’s Permissive Nature and Launcher Dependencies
In contrast to iOS, the Android operating system typically provides a more permissive environment for application icon customization. Many third-party launchers, which serve as alternative home screen interfaces, offer built-in functionalities to replace application icons directly. This approach bypasses the need for workarounds, providing a more seamless user experience. However, reliance on third-party launchers introduces a dependency on external software, raising concerns about security vulnerabilities and the potential for data collection. The level of customization is contingent upon the launcher’s capabilities and the user’s willingness to trust external applications.

Launcher Applications
Launcher applications, primarily available on Android, replace the device’s default home screen interface, offering extensive customization options, including the ability to change application icons. Launchers often provide built-in icon replacement features, simplifying the process compared to native operating system methods. For example, a user could use Nova Launcher or Action Launcher to assign a custom image to the Instagram application icon. However, relying on a third-party launcher introduces a dependency on external software, potentially impacting system performance and raising concerns about data privacy. The user must evaluate the launcher’s resource consumption and reputation before installation.
-
Shortcut Creation Apps on iOS
On iOS, where direct icon replacement is restricted, third-party applications that facilitate shortcut creation, such as “Shortcuts,” offer a workaround. These applications allow users to create custom icons that link to the Instagram application, effectively masking the original icon. For example, a user could create a shortcut with a custom image and name, which then opens the Instagram application when tapped. However, this method does not directly modify the application icon itself and may introduce a slight delay when launching the application through the shortcut. Furthermore, the user must manage these shortcuts to prevent clutter on the home screen.

The relationship between image format and icon appearance extends beyond mere compatibility. Different image formats employ varying compression algorithms, which directly affect image quality and file size. Using a highly compressed image format, even if compatible, can lead to a pixelated or blurry icon, undermining the visual enhancement intended by the replacement. Conversely, using an uncompressed format, while preserving image quality, can result in a larger file size, potentially impacting device storage and performance. A practical example involves selecting a lossless PNG format for icons with intricate details and transparency, whereas a JPEG format might be suitable for simpler icons where compression artifacts are less noticeable. Question 1: Is it possible to directly modify the Instagram application’s icon on iOS without jailbreaking the device?
Direct modification of the Instagram application’s core files, including its icon, is not possible on iOS devices without jailbreaking. The operating system’s security protocols prevent such alterations. Workarounds, such as utilizing the “Shortcuts” application, create a proxy icon that links to the Instagram application but does not directly alter the original application’s resources.
Question 2: What are the limitations of using third-party launchers on Android for icon customization?
While third-party launchers on Android provide greater flexibility for icon customization, they introduce dependencies on external software. These launchers may consume system resources, potentially impacting device performance. Additionally, their security and privacy practices require careful evaluation to mitigate the risk of malware or data collection.
